Try this too, remove the decklid inside the car. There are two connectors that should be plugged into the speakers. And yes that large group of wires is suppose to be connected. fish your hand throught the pocket on the drivers side behind the back seat.
 
There is a two-part Mach 460 specific harness. The first part leads from the amp under the radio to the driver's side, and the other half continues from that point along the left side of the car (following the wiring harness already there) to connect to the rear deck.

The original speaker wiring in the car and amp is hooked up to the tweeters in the Mach 460. The two amps in the rear tray drive ALL FOUR main speakers. This means that thew wiring harness I mentioned brings non-amplified audio to the rear amps then brings it back to the front doors. Kinda weird, huh?

I've done the Mach 460 installation myself, so I can definitely help you. A question for you: Did your Mustang have the Premium Sound option? Premium Sound already had an amp under the radio; it's a different amp than the Mach 460 one. Mustangs with Premium Sound already has wiring for the Mach 460 in the doors. If you didn't have Premium Sound, your Mach 460 installation is a LOT harder, and may not be possible.

Sounds like the doors are wired up properly. There should be two plugs in the rear already that went to the old speakers back there. Those plug into the two plugs on the top of the speaker tray, and will get you sound to the rear tweeters.

There is an extra wiring harness you will need that plus into the loose connectors that runs to the plug in the rear deck. I don't have a source for you, unfortunately, except for eBay.
 
So far I've found 2 connectors underneath the reardeck, a small flat one and a bigger round one, that correct? No wiring though, so I'm probably gonna have to find the wiring that connects those with the front wiring harness..
 
That's correct. The remaining harness does reach back to the rear deck AND hooks up to the two amps and the connectors you mentioned. It's all one harness, I thought the harness leading to the rear deck and the one on the rear deck were separate.
